Product features
- Soft 3-end fleece with a soft hand-feel and medium-heavy (280 g/m²) fabric
- Adjustable hood with self-colored drawstrings and metal grommets
- Spacious kangaroo pouch pocket to keep hands warm
- Embroidered left-chest detail plus large vintage-style back print; embroidery placement available
- Durable construction: double-needle topstitch, neck twill tape, tear-away label, under 5% shrinkage
